**Ticket: Partition config drift — Ledgerline events table**

Monthly partitioning on the Ledgerline events table drifted: staging creates partitions three months ahead, prod only one. Caused a missed-partition incident last week. Don't hand-edit the scheduler; fix the config in repo and redeploy. Align every environment to the canonical settings, which follow.

deployment values, yadug-bawif:
[framir]
team = pelox
access_code = ac_a38ab2
owner = tamion.julael
host = framir.tolvaqlabs.test
port = 11211
peer = tammir.zemvargrid.local
salt = 2215ef03
pin = 1541

Leadership Review Briefing

Quick update for the board: the search for a second-source supplier for the Pindrel valve line is going well. We've shortlisted two fabricators, Orvane Works and Kestwick Forming, and site visits wrap next week. Costs look comparable. Here's the confidential note on where we're heading next.

confidential, bafof-bawip: Sordorox Logistics is in early talks to buy Sorixox Systems for about $17.6 million. The Jorox launch date is January 3, and nothing goes to the press before then.

Runbook: charset sniffing for Textbin uploads. The detector (Glyphsort v3) samples the first 64 KB, scores candidate encodings, and falls back to UTF-8 with replacement on ties. Reviewers should confirm the fallback metric is emitted before merging changes. Detection results are cached in Redsill; the worker authenticates to the cache using a credential defined in its env file, set on the line below.

vault entry, yahif-yajep: COURIER_KEY29=b802bdf8034096b65a51c6ba5abe2